Kafka Eagle:揭秘Kafka监控工具的强大功能
2023-11-16 16:25:38
Kafka Eagle:监控 Kafka 集群的强大帮手
实时洞察 Kafka 集群状态
Kafka Eagle 是监控 Apache Kafka 集群的利器,提供全面的实时监控和管理功能。它可以让你实时了解集群状态,深入洞察数据流传输状况、消费者组和主题状态,并及时发现性能瓶颈和异常情况。有了 Kafka Eagle,你就能时刻掌握 Kafka 集群的运行情况,快速识别和解决潜在问题,确保数据安全和业务连续性。
强大的报警系统,及时预警风险
Kafka Eagle 的报警系统功能强大,可实时监控 Kafka 集群的各种异常情况和性能指标,并及时预警。一旦发生问题或潜在风险,Kafka Eagle 会立即通过邮件、短信、微信等多种方式通知相关负责人,以便他们及时采取行动,规避风险、保障数据安全,确保关键业务的稳定运行。
灵活定制,满足不同需求
Kafka Eagle 支持灵活的定制配置,允许你根据自身需求调整监控指标、报警阈值和通知方式。通过定制功能,你可以对 Kafka 集群进行更细粒度的监控,满足不同业务场景的需求,从而确保 Kafka 集群的稳定运行和数据安全。
简洁直观的界面,操作简单
Kafka Eagle 界面简洁直观,易于操作。即使是初次使用该工具的用户也能快速掌握。你可以通过一个清晰简洁的控制面板,实时查看 Kafka 集群的各项指标和状态。Kafka Eagle 还提供了详细的文档和教程,帮助你快速上手,充分利用该工具的强大功能,为 Kafka 集群提供全面监控和保护。
广泛的应用场景,满足不同行业需求
Kafka Eagle 广泛适用于金融、电商、制造、医疗等各行各业。在这些行业中,Kafka Eagle 被广泛用于监测生产环境中的 Kafka 集群,确保数据完整性和高可用性。此外,Kafka Eagle 还被用于开发和测试环境中,帮助开发人员快速发现和解决 Kafka 集群问题,提高开发效率。
代码示例
下面是一个使用 Kafka Eagle 监控 Kafka 集群的示例代码:
# 创建一个 Kafka Eagle 配置文件
eagle.conf = {
"kafka.brokers": "localhost:9092",
"kafka.topics": ["test-topic"],
"kafka.consumer_groups": ["test-consumer-group"],
"email.recipients": ["admin@example.com"],
"sms.recipients": ["1234567890"],
"wechat.recipients": ["wxid_1234567890"]
}
# 创建一个 Kafka Eagle 对象
eagle = KafkaEagle(eagle.conf)
# 启动 Kafka Eagle
eagle.start()
常见问题解答
1. Kafka Eagle 是免费的吗?
Kafka Eagle 是开源且免费的。
2. Kafka Eagle 支持哪些 Kafka 版本?
Kafka Eagle 支持 Kafka 0.10 及更高版本。
3. Kafka Eagle 可以监控多个 Kafka 集群吗?
Kafka Eagle 可以监控多个 Kafka 集群。
4. Kafka Eagle 可以与其他监控工具集成吗?
Kafka Eagle 可以与其他监控工具集成,如 Prometheus、Grafana 和 Splunk。
5. Kafka Eagle 如何帮助我提高 Kafka 集群的性能?
Kafka Eagle 可以帮助你实时识别性能瓶颈和异常情况,以便你可以采取措施提高 Kafka 集群的性能。